Ordinals
beta
Sat 1130911981829181
decimal
242364.1981829181
degree
0°32364′444″1981829181‴
percentile
53.852951574913554%
name
fvlpffekffw
cycle
0
epoch
1
period
120
block
242364
offset
1981829181
timestamp
2013-06-20 00:50:33 UTC
rarity
common
prev
next